源码如何上传到服务器上,源码上传到服务器的详细指南与实操步骤
- 综合资讯
- 2024-10-19 10:12:41
- 1

将源码上传到服务器,请遵循以下步骤:确保你的源码文件已准备好并压缩(可选)。使用SSH或FTP客户端连接到服务器。在服务器上创建存放源码的目录。使用文件传输功能将压缩文...
将源码上传到服务器,请遵循以下步骤:确保你的源码文件已准备好并压缩(可选)。使用SSH或FTP客户端连接到服务器。在服务器上创建存放源码的目录。使用文件传输功能将压缩文件上传到该目录。解压文件以释放源码。配置环境变量和运行必要的安装脚本。确保在每次更新时备份现有代码,以避免数据丢失。
随着互联网的飞速发展,源码上传到服务器已经成为程序员日常工作中不可或缺的一部分,无论是个人项目还是企业级应用,将源码上传到服务器是确保项目稳定运行的前提,本文将详细介绍源码上传到服务器的步骤和方法,旨在帮助读者轻松掌握这一技能。
准备工作
1、获取服务器IP地址和用户名
您需要向服务器管理员索取服务器的IP地址和登录用户名,这是连接服务器的基础信息。
2、安装SSH客户端
SSH(Secure Shell)是一种网络协议,用于计算机之间的安全通信,在Windows、macOS和Linux系统中,都内置了SSH客户端,如果您使用的是Windows系统,建议下载并安装PuTTY等第三方SSH客户端。
3、生成SSH密钥
为了提高安全性,建议您使用SSH密钥对进行登录,在生成密钥对时,请确保将私钥保存在本地,并妥善保管。
源码上传步骤
1、连接到服务器
打开SSH客户端,输入以下命令连接到服务器:
ssh username@server_ip
username
为您的用户名,server_ip
为服务器的IP地址。
2、创建项目目录
在服务器上创建一个用于存放项目文件的目录,创建一个名为project
的目录:
mkdir /path/to/project cd /path/to/project
3、克隆本地仓库到服务器
如果您使用Git进行版本控制,可以使用以下命令将本地仓库克隆到服务器:
git clone /path/to/your/local/repo
4、上传本地文件
如果您不使用版本控制,可以使用以下命令将本地文件上传到服务器:
scp /path/to/your/local/file username@server_ip:/path/to/project
5、解压上传的文件
如果您上传的是压缩文件,可以使用以下命令解压:
tar -zxvf /path/to/project/file.tar.gz -C /path/to/project
6、配置项目
根据项目需求,进行必要的配置操作,如设置环境变量、数据库连接等。
7、启动项目
根据项目类型,启动相应服务,如Nginx、Apache、Tomcat等。
注意事项
1、服务器权限
确保您具有足够的权限来执行上述操作,如果权限不足,请联系服务器管理员。
2、安全性
使用SSH密钥对登录,避免使用明文密码,定期更换密钥,以保证账户安全。
3、文件传输
在传输大量文件时,建议使用SSH SFTP(Secure File Transfer Protocol)或rsync等工具,以提高传输效率和安全性。
4、监控日志
定期检查服务器日志,以便及时发现并解决问题。
本文详细介绍了源码上传到服务器的步骤和方法,通过掌握这些技巧,您可以轻松地将项目部署到服务器,确保项目的稳定运行,在实际操作过程中,请根据项目需求进行调整,祝您顺利!
本文链接:https://www.zhitaoyun.cn/176462.html
发表评论